How fermentation shapes your wine’s health profile
Wine undergoes two primary fermentation processes, each drastically affecting its chemical composition. “The alcoholic fermentation by yeasts transforms grape sugars into alcohol, while malolactic fermentation conducted by bacteria converts harsh malic acid into softer lactic acid,” explains Dr. Elaine Cordero, enologist and nutritional biochemist. “These processes don’t just change flavor—they completely rewrite the wine’s health footprint.”
Different fermentation approaches yield varying levels of phenolic compounds—powerful antioxidants responsible for many of wine’s potential health benefits. Red wines typically contain more of these beneficial molecules due to extended skin contact during fermentation, contributing to their anti-inflammatory properties.
However, not all fermentation byproducts are beneficial. Some wine-related headaches come from biogenic amines like histamine and tyramine, which form during malolactic fermentation. Their concentration varies dramatically based on fermentation conditions, yeast strains, and grape varieties.

Choosing wines for optimal health benefits
Not all wines offer the same health profile. Consider these factors when selecting wine for both enjoyment and potential health benefits:
- Fermentation duration – Longer fermentations typically allow for greater extraction of beneficial compounds
- Yeast selection – Different strains produce varying levels of sulfur compounds and biogenic amines
- Natural vs. commercial processes – Minimal intervention approaches often preserve more bioactive compounds
